Total Student Population Comparison

The total student population of selected colleges is 10,565 with 5,954 female students and 4,611 male students. This enrollment statistics is based on the latest data from IPEDS, U.S. Department of Education for academic year 2022-2023. The following table compares the student population for both undergraduate and graduate schools between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Bradley University has the most enrolled students of 5,552, while American Islamic College has the least number of students of 19 for both in graduate and undergraduate programs.

Undergraduate Student Population

The total undergraduate population of selected colleges is 7,744 with 4,298 female students and 3,446 male students. The following table compares 2022-2023 undergraduate enrollment between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Bradley University has the most enrolled undergraduate students of 4,143, while American Islamic College has the least number of undergraduate students of 10.

Graduate Student Population

The total graduate population of selected colleges is 2,821 with 1,656 female students and 1,165 male students. The following table compares 2022-2023 graduate enrollment between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Bradley University has the most enrolled graduate students of 1,409, while American Islamic College has the least number of graduate students of 9.

Distance Learning (Online Class) Enrollment

The following table compares 2022-2023 distance learning enrollment for both undergraduate and graduate programs between selected colleges. In undergraduate programs, out of total 7,744 students, 114 students (1.47%) have taken courses only through distance learning and 3,277 students (42.32%) have learned from at least one online course. For graduate schools, out of total 2,821 students, 1,344 students (47.64%) have taken courses only through distance learning and 525 students (18.61%) have learned from at least one online course.
